Output 3d926cfcfc83674fe3599c7204807a8b3bb85220ed432e889f007bdc9a81b9de:0

value
1080590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f974c40f10fc4a4db43f0221693e2e77465d9743 OP_EQUAL
address
3QS24LsJocB18BuhrP19UC7Mv7QRBx2ak8
transaction
3d926cfcfc83674fe3599c7204807a8b3bb85220ed432e889f007bdc9a81b9de
spent
true